> GPLv3, Microsoft/Novell language
>
> ,----[ Quote ]
>| Translating that into plain English, it says: If you distribute GPLd
>| software and make a deal with another company who also distributes (some
>| kind of) software, we will stop you from distributing the GPLd
>| software if:
>|
>| a) you pay the other company
>| b) the deal mentions the GPLd software
>| c) you get a patent license
>| d) the patent license mentions the GPLd software
>| e) the patent license has more limited terms than the GPL license on the
>| software
